How they compare
Chile currently reports 411,382 1000 USD against 76 1000 USD in Bolivia (Plurinational State of), a difference of 411,306 1000 USD.
That makes Chile's figure about 5,412.9 times Bolivia (Plurinational State of)'s.
Across all 22 years both countries report, Chile has been ahead every year.
Bolivia (Plurinational State of) ranks 4th and Chile ranks 4th of 7 groups.
Chile has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
